Riverside Walk is a residential street with 18 addresses.
It ranks as the 204th largest and 236th most expensive of the 277 streets in the LS23 area. The dominant property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 18 properties: 18 houses.
Sale prices range from £504,072 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,022 ft2) to £710,772 for 5 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,851 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,563 pcm for 3 bed houses to £1,992 pcm for 5 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 3.4% and 3.7%.
The average value per square foot is £384.
The last sale on Riverside Walk sold for £760,000 on 31st May 2024. Since then prices are down an average of 3.1%.
The current average value in the street is £657,308.
The Riverside Walk Sales Market has increased by 32.9% over the last 10 years.

The current average rental value in the street is £1,879.
The Riverside Walk Rental Market has increased by 45.2% over the last 10 years.

The last sale was on 31st May 2024 for £760,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 3.1%. The street has had a total of 24 sales since 1995.
Riverside Walk, Boston Spa, Wetherby, LS23 has seen 1 sale in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
Riverside Walk, Boston Spa, Wetherby, LS23 is the 204th largest and the 236th most expensive street in the LS23 area.
There is 1 postcode on Riverside Walk, Boston Spa, Wetherby, LS23.
The closest station to Riverside Walk, Boston Spa, Wetherby, LS23 is Cattal station which is 10.2 kilometres away.
